Many years ago, a Thursday morning in a rural Scottish court. Drunk driver appears in court, pleads guilty, fined £500, banned 3 years (third offence). Clerk of court (yours truly) goes back to office, sits down at desk, sees said drunk driver get into car which is parked in front of court and drive off.

Quick phone call to police station next door.

Friday morning, now disqualified driver, who was also drunk from over indulging on the Wednesday night, appears in court again in front of fairly annoyed Sheriff.

3 months in jail, banned for 15 years.

Some people are stupid.
